Our aw-shucks Tony Bennett wasn’t a likely candidate for a TV desk, and I don’t see him coaching again – he’s too good for college, with NIL and the portal, and he’s ill-suited to holding a clipboard for NBA guys on max contracts.

But working with an NBA team as a draft adviser? Oh, yeah.

With the Los Angeles Lakers? Obviously.

“As we refine and build out our NBA draft and scouting processes, we could think of no better basketball mind than Tony Bennett to have as a resource,” Lakers president and GM Rob Pelinka said in a statement released on Wednesday, announcing the addition of TB to the front office staff.

We just had the ceremony for Bennett that put his name on the court at JPJ on Saturday.

During the ceremony, Bennett quipped that his wife, Laurel, told him that “retired me is a lot more fun and enjoyable than coaching me.”

“I’m glad she said that, because you spend a lot more time together when you’re retired,” Bennett said.

You can imagine Laurel telling Tony, Yeah, retired you is more fun and all, but seriously, you need to get out of the house every once in a while.

“When Rob and I began talking, what stood out to me was the chance to help out such a storied organization,” Bennett said in a statement in the Lakers press release.

“The Lakers carry a tradition that speaks for itself, so to be connected to it and assist Rob and the Lakers in any way I can is exciting,” Bennett said.

No doubt, Laurel said to him, Tony, you need a hobby.
